At its core, an HVAC price book is a structured catalog of every repair, replacement, accessory, and maintenance task your company sells, with a fixed price for each line item. Instead of techs calculating time and materials on the customer's driveway, they tap a tablet, show the homeowner a clean number, and either get approval or they don't. The customer knows the price before work starts, and the technician never has to defend an hourly rate.

The shift toward flat rate pricing accelerated dramatically after 2020 as labor costs climbed, parts availability tightened, and homeowners demanded upfront transparency. Industry data from Service Nation, Nexstar Network, and the ACCA shows that contractors using a structured price book average 22 to 38 percent higher gross margins than time-and-materials shops, with customer satisfaction scores actually trending higher because there are no billing surprises at the end of a sweaty August afternoon.

The Five Core Components of a Professional HVAC Price Book

๐Ÿ”ง Repair Task Library

The largest section, often 600 to 1,200 individual repair tasks covering capacitors, contactors, blower motors, igniters, control boards, refrigerant leaks, drain line clears, and every common failure across furnaces, air conditioners, heat pumps, and mini-splits.

๐Ÿ“ฆ Equipment Replacement Menu

Pre-built good-better-best packages for system replacements, including the equipment, line set, pad, disconnect, permit, startup, and labor as one bundled price the homeowner can compare without spreadsheet math.

๐ŸŒฌ๏ธ Indoor Air Quality Add-Ons

Media filters, UV lights, electronic air cleaners, humidifiers, dehumidifiers, ERVs, and duct sanitizing services priced as individual line items or bundled into maintenance and replacement quotes.

๐Ÿ“… Maintenance Agreements

Tiered membership pricing covering one or two precision tune-ups per year, priority scheduling, discounted repairs, and waived diagnostic fees, sold monthly or annually as recurring revenue.

๐Ÿงฐ Accessories and Diagnostics

Diagnostic fee, after-hours surcharge, thermostat upgrades, refrigerant per pound, condensate pumps, surge protectors, and miscellaneous parts that pad average ticket without lengthening the service call.

Flat rate pricing and time-and-materials billing are two fundamentally different philosophies, and the choice between them shapes everything from how you train technicians to how customers perceive your brand. Time and materials, the older model, charges an hourly labor rate plus parts at a marked-up cost. Flat rate, the modern standard, assigns a single fixed price to each defined task regardless of how long it actually takes the technician to complete the work in the field.

The math behind flat rate looks simple but hides genuine sophistication. Every task in the book is built from three inputs: the average parts cost across your local supply houses, an estimated labor time based on a competent technician working at a reasonable pace, and a multiplier that covers overhead, truck cost, warranty exposure, callbacks, training, insurance, taxes, and profit. The result is a price that the homeowner sees, agrees to, and pays without watching the clock anxiously while the tech works.

Customers overwhelmingly prefer flat rate because it eliminates the anxiety of an open meter. A homeowner who hears "I charge $165 an hour plus parts" mentally starts calculating, hoping the tech is fast, suspicious if the tech is slow. The same homeowner hearing "the repair is $412 and I can have your AC running in about an hour" simply decides yes or no. The decision is cleaner, and the close rate is measurably higher across thousands of shops that have made the switch.

From the contractor's perspective, flat rate also protects margins on hard jobs. If a technician underestimates a repair and it takes ninety minutes instead of forty-five, the company still gets paid the agreed price. The averaging across hundreds of repairs evens out, and the truly difficult jobs subsidize the easy ones in a way that keeps technicians moving rather than sandbagging to bill more hours. The most common objection to flat rate is that it feels expensive on quick jobs. A two-minute capacitor swap for $389 looks outrageous if you only consider the part itself, which costs the contractor twelve dollars. But that price covers truck stocking, the diagnostic visit, the technician's hourly burden including benefits and taxes, the dispatcher who scheduled the call, the warranty on parts and labor, the office that processed the invoice, the building lease, and yes, a margin for the owner who took the risk to start the company.

Time and materials still has a niche, primarily in commercial service contracts where buildings have engineering staff who can verify hours and where customers have negotiated specific labor rates. For residential service, however, flat rate has become the industry standard, and any contractor still billing by the hour in 2026 is leaving substantial revenue on the table while creating friction with every customer.

The transition from time-and-materials to flat rate typically lifts average ticket by 30 to 50 percent in the first year, with no decline in close rate when technicians are properly trained on presentation. The price didn't change โ€” the way it's communicated changed, and that change happens to align with how modern consumers want to buy services in every other category of their lives.

Three Pricing Models Used in the HVAC Service Pricing Strategy Playbook

๐Ÿ“‹ Cost-Plus Markup

Cost-plus is the simplest pricing model, where the contractor takes the wholesale parts cost and multiplies it by a fixed factor to determine the customer price. Typical residential markups range from 3.5 to 5.0 times wholesale, with the multiplier covering overhead, labor, warranty, and profit in one bundled number that's easy to calculate but harder to defend on premium items.

The danger of pure cost-plus is that it underprices high-labor, low-parts repairs and overprices low-labor, high-parts jobs. A blower motor that costs $180 wholesale and takes three hours to install bills the same as a $180 part swapped in fifteen minutes, which makes no sense from a labor-recovery standpoint. Most mature shops have moved away from straight cost-plus toward task-based pricing for this reason.

๐Ÿ“‹ Task-Based Flat Rate

Task-based flat rate is the modern gold standard, building each price from a target hourly recovery rate multiplied by estimated labor time, then adding the marked-up parts cost. A target labor recovery of $250 per hour times 0.75 hours plus a $48 part marked up 4x gives a task price of $379.50, which becomes a clean $389 line item in the book after rounding for presentation.

This model rewards efficient technicians, properly compensates difficult repairs, and creates predictable margins across the whole task library. It does require more upfront math to build but software like Profit Rhino and Coolfront automates the calculations once you input your labor rate and overhead. The result is a price book where every line item carries the same percentage gross profit regardless of mix.

๐Ÿ“‹ Good-Better-Best Tiered

Good-better-best presentation overlays any underlying pricing model with a structured choice architecture that dramatically lifts average ticket. Instead of one option, the technician presents three: a basic repair, a repair plus related improvements, and a comprehensive solution that addresses the root cause and adjacent risks the system will likely face within twelve months.

Research from behavioral economics confirms that buyers given three tiered options spend 17 to 32 percent more on average than buyers given a single quote, with the middle option chosen most frequently. The good tier anchors the conversation, the best tier makes the middle look reasonable, and the customer walks away feeling like they made an informed choice rather than being sold to by a pushy technician.

Build Your HVAC Price Book Step by Step

Calculate your true burdened hourly labor cost including taxes, benefits, and insurance
Pull six months of parts invoices to establish current average wholesale costs
Determine your target gross margin, typically 55 to 65 percent on residential service
Build a master labor recovery rate that covers overhead, truck cost, and target profit
List every common repair task your technicians perform, aiming for 400 to 800 line items minimum
Assign a realistic labor time estimate for each task based on technician timing studies
Apply your markup multiplier consistently to wholesale parts costs across the book
Add good-better-best tiers to high-volume repairs and all equipment replacements
Load the price book into mobile-friendly software your technicians can use on tablets
Schedule quarterly reviews to adjust for refrigerant price changes and supply house increases
Your Labor Recovery Rate Determines Everything Else

Most failing HVAC contractors discover too late that their labor recovery rate was set too low. A shop billing technicians at $150 per hour might actually need $285 per hour to cover all overhead, truck costs, warranty exposure, and target profit. Calculate this number first, then build every flat rate task around it. Without the right recovery rate, no markup strategy can save your margins.

The markup math behind a profitable HVAC price book is where most contractors either thrive or quietly bleed cash for years before realizing what's wrong. Let's walk through the actual calculations using real 2026 numbers so you can audit your own pricing and identify where money is leaking out of your business through underpriced tasks or unrealistic labor estimates.

Start with burdened labor cost. A technician earning $32 per hour in wages actually costs the company closer to $52 per hour once you add payroll taxes at roughly 8 percent, workers compensation insurance at 4 to 12 percent depending on your state, health benefits averaging $700 monthly, paid time off, training, uniforms, phone, and the unpaid time between calls. That $52 burdened rate is your real labor cost before you've added a single dollar of overhead or profit.

Next layer in overhead. The truck costs $800 monthly to lease and operate including fuel, insurance, maintenance, and inventory shrinkage. Office overhead, dispatch, marketing, software subscriptions, accounting, and rent typically add another $1,200 to $1,800 per technician per month. Divided across roughly 140 billable hours in a month, overhead and truck cost add about $18 to $22 to your hourly burden, pushing the real cost to keep that technician productive to roughly $72 per hour.

Now add your target net profit, typically 15 to 22 percent for a well-run residential service shop. Working backward from those margins, the labor billing rate needs to land between $235 and $295 per hour. That feels shocking compared to the $150 hourly rate many small shops still quote, but the math doesn't lie โ€” if you're billing below $235 per hour fully loaded, you're either losing money or underpaying your team. Parts markup follows similar logic but with a different math. Wholesale parts costs vary wildly by item, but the markup multiplier covers the cost of carrying inventory, warranty exposure on the part, the risk of obsolescence, and the technician's time to source and stock the part. A 3.5x multiplier is the residential service minimum, 4.0x to 5.0x is standard, and premium items like control boards and ECM motors often carry multipliers of 4.5x to 6.0x because of warranty exposure and the technical complexity of replacement.

Refrigerant pricing deserves special attention because volatility has been extreme since the phasedown of R-410A accelerated. R-454B, R-32, and other A2L refrigerants are now standard in new equipment, but legacy R-410A and R-22 charging remains common service work. Smart price books update refrigerant pricing monthly based on supply house quotes, with markups of 3x to 5x on the per-pound wholesale cost depending on the refrigerant and the difficulty of recovery and recharge work.

Finally, build in deliberate margin protection on accessories and add-ons. Surge protectors, condensate pumps, hard-start kits, thermostats, and indoor air quality upgrades carry higher markup multipliers โ€” often 5x to 8x โ€” because they're impulse purchases the customer wasn't planning to make. These items don't compete with online pricing in the customer's mind the way a furnace or AC unit does, so they're where your margin enhancement lives. A well-built price book pulls 18 to 25 percent of gross revenue from accessories and add-ons that customers happily purchase when properly presented.

Maintaining a price book is not a once-a-year spreadsheet exercise โ€” it's an ongoing operational discipline that separates contractors with stable margins from those who watch profit erode quarter by quarter. The shops achieving consistent 18 to 22 percent net profit treat their price book the way an airline treats yield management: as a living system that gets attention every week, not a static document that gathers dust until tax season exposes the damage.

The first maintenance habit is monthly parts cost reconciliation. Pull the previous month's parts purchases from your supply house accounts and compare actual paid costs against the wholesale figures embedded in your price book. Even a 6 percent drift on common items like capacitors, contactors, and igniters can shave two full percentage points off your gross margin if left uncorrected for a year. Most price book software platforms now connect directly to major supply houses for automated cost feeds.

Quarterly labor recovery audits matter just as much. Calculate your actual revenue per billable hour from the previous quarter and compare it to your target. If you targeted $265 per hour and actually achieved $241, the gap is telling you that either your task time estimates are too generous, your technicians are discounting in the field, or your dispatch is losing billable hours to drive time and warranty callbacks. Technician training on price presentation is the next pillar. The best price book in the country produces mediocre revenue when delivered by a technician who mumbles the price, apologizes for it, or volunteers discounts before the customer has even responded. Role-play sessions, ride-alongs with senior technicians, and recorded call reviews where managers listen for price-presentation language are how top shops move technicians from average ticket of $480 to $920 on the same task library.

Seasonal price book adjustments are another mature shop habit. Demand surges during the first week of every cooling season and the first cold snap of heating season. Some contractors layer in modest peak pricing on emergency calls during these windows, while others keep prices flat but tighten dispatch to favor maintenance members. The decision is strategic, but having a documented seasonal pricing policy beats making ad-hoc decisions when the phones explode at six in the morning.

Membership program pricing requires its own dedicated maintenance cycle. Maintenance agreements typically need annual price increases of 3 to 5 percent to keep pace with rising parts and labor costs, but the increases have to be communicated carefully to existing members. Best practice is grandfathering current members for one renewal cycle, then implementing increases on renewal with clear value reinforcement showing what's included. A well-maintained membership base producing recurring revenue is the single best margin stabilizer any HVAC business can build.

Finally, benchmark your pricing against competitors quarterly. Use mystery shopping, supply house gossip, or services like Service Roundtable's pricing surveys to understand where your prices sit in the local market. Being 15 to 25 percent above the cheapest competitor is healthy positioning that signals quality without scaring customers away. Being the cheapest is almost always a sign that something is wrong with your math, your overhead, or your understanding of what your work is actually worth.

Putting your HVAC price book into daily practice requires more than uploading a task library to a tablet โ€” it requires building habits and accountability systems that keep pricing discipline intact even on the busiest, sweatiest service days. The contractors who get this right tend to share a small set of operational practices that any shop can adopt regardless of size or sophistication.

Start with pre-call huddles. Every morning, dispatch reviews the day's calls with technicians, flags any historical members or repeat customers, and aligns on which calls have replacement upgrade potential. Technicians arrive at each appointment knowing the customer's history, equipment age, and most likely repair categories, which lets them present pricing with confidence rather than discovering surprises mid-call that derail their presentation.

Invest in tablet-based presentation tools. Showing a homeowner a clean digital quote with photos of the failed part, the new part, and the bundled options creates a fundamentally different sales conversation than scribbling numbers on the back of a business card. The visual quote alone lifts close rates by 12 to 18 percent in nearly every shop that adopts it, and modern price book platforms make this almost automatic once configured.

Train technicians on objection handling, not selling. Most customer pushback on price is actually a request for reassurance, not a demand for a discount. Phrases like "that price includes a two-year warranty on parts and labor and we'll be back if anything goes wrong" address the real concern. Technicians who reflexively cut price at the first sign of hesitation train customers to negotiate every future call, eroding margins permanently across the customer base.

Use callback data to refine the price book. If a particular repair generates a warranty callback rate above 5 percent, the price book entry is probably underestimating labor time, which encourages technicians to rush the work. Lengthen the task time, raise the price, and the callback rate typically drops while customer satisfaction rises. The price book and the quality assurance program are deeply connected, even though most shops manage them as separate domains.

Run a quarterly price book audit with your top technicians. They know which tasks are too cheap, which tasks customers reliably balk at, and which add-ons sell well in different neighborhoods. Their field intelligence is gold for refining the book, and involving them in the process builds buy-in for the prices they have to defend to homeowners every day. Top shops formalize this as a structured meeting with concrete outputs, not a casual conversation.

Finally, measure what matters. Average ticket, close rate, callback rate, gross margin by service category, and revenue per billable hour are the five core metrics every shop should track weekly. The price book is the lever you pull to move these numbers, but you only know which way to pull it if you're measuring consistently. Software dashboards make this easy in 2026 โ€” the only excuse for not tracking is choosing not to look, and shops that don't look rarely survive five years.

What is an HVAC price book?

An HVAC price book is a structured catalog of every repair, replacement, accessory, and maintenance task a contractor sells, with a fixed flat rate price for each item. It replaces hourly time-and-materials billing with upfront pricing that customers approve before work begins. Modern price books are software-based, sync to technician tablets, and update parts costs automatically from supply house feeds for accuracy.

How much should HVAC contractors mark up parts?

Typical residential HVAC parts markups range from 3.5x to 5.0x wholesale cost, with premium items like control boards and ECM motors reaching 5.0x to 6.0x because of warranty exposure. Accessories like surge protectors, hard-start kits, and IAQ products often carry 5x to 8x multipliers. The markup covers overhead, labor, warranty, truck stocking, and target profit margin, not just the part itself.

What is the difference between flat rate and time and materials pricing?

Flat rate pricing assigns a single fixed price to each defined task regardless of how long the work takes, presented before approval. Time and materials charges hourly labor plus marked-up parts, billed after the work is completed. Flat rate dominates residential service because it eliminates customer billing anxiety and protects contractor margins on difficult jobs that exceed estimated time.

How often should an HVAC price book be updated?

Parts costs should be reconciled monthly against actual supply house invoices, with the price book adjusted for any drift greater than 5 percent. Labor recovery rates and markup multipliers should be audited quarterly. Refrigerant pricing often needs monthly updates due to ongoing volatility from the A2L transition. A full price book review with technician input belongs on the calendar every six to twelve months.

What software is best for managing an HVAC price book?

Leading platforms include ServiceTitan for larger shops, Housecall Pro and FieldEdge for mid-size operations, and Profit Rhino, Coolfront, and Callahan Roach for contractors who want pre-built task libraries. Each integrates pricing with dispatch, invoicing, and customer management. Subscription costs range from $50 to $400 per user monthly depending on platform and features included.

What is a good gross margin for an HVAC service business?

Well-run residential HVAC service shops target 55 to 65 percent gross margin on repairs and 30 to 45 percent on equipment replacements. Net profit after all overhead typically lands between 15 and 22 percent for top operators. Shops below 10 percent net profit usually have either an underpriced book, undertrained technicians presenting prices weakly, or hidden overhead leaks they haven't identified yet.

How do you build a flat rate task price?

Build each task from three inputs: average wholesale parts cost from your local supply houses, estimated labor time based on competent technician pacing, and a markup multiplier covering overhead and profit. Multiply parts cost by your markup, multiply labor time by your hourly recovery rate, add the two, and round to a presentable number. Most task libraries contain 600 to 1,800 line items at maturity.

Why are HVAC repairs so expensive?

The visible part of an HVAC repair is the component, but the price also covers the technician's burdened wage including benefits and taxes, fully loaded truck and inventory cost, warranty exposure on parts and labor, office and dispatch overhead, insurance, training, and a reasonable profit margin for the business owner. A $389 capacitor replacement covers a system that delivers a trained tech to your home reliably.

Should HVAC contractors use good-better-best pricing?

Yes, good-better-best presentation reliably lifts average ticket by 17 to 32 percent compared to single-option quotes, with no decline in close rate. The middle option is chosen most often, the good tier anchors affordability, and the best tier makes the middle look reasonable. Use it on all equipment replacements and on high-volume repair categories where add-ons or root cause solutions are available.

What is a labor recovery rate in HVAC pricing?

Labor recovery rate is the effective hourly billing rate a contractor needs to charge to cover burdened wages, overhead, truck cost, warranty exposure, and target profit. Most residential service shops need a recovery rate of $235 to $295 per hour fully loaded in 2026. This is the foundational number behind every flat rate task โ€” if it's set too low, no markup strategy can rescue your margins.
